Overview
Hollins University is a private institution that was founded in 1842. It has a total undergraduate enrollment of 691 (fall 2022), and the campus size is 475 acres. It utilizes a 4-1-4-based academic calendar. Hollins University's ranking in the 2024 edition of Best Colleges is National Liberal Arts Colleges, #124. Its tuition and fees are $41,210.
